Commit 29ab65b3 authored by Christoph Cullmann's avatar Christoph Cullmann 🐮
Browse files

fix the evaluation of hard coded list: [filename, ...] projects

parent 77a61d2a
......@@ -292,6 +292,15 @@ QStringList KateProjectWorker::findFiles(const QDir &dir, const QVariantMap &fil
*/
QStringList userGivenFilesList = filesEntry[QStringLiteral("list")].toStringList();
if (!userGivenFilesList.empty()) {
/**
* make the files absolute relative to current dir
* all code later requires this and the filesFrom... routines do this, too, internally
* even without this, the tree views will show them, but opening them will create new elements!
*/
for (auto &file : userGivenFilesList) {
file = dir.absoluteFilePath(file);
}
/**
* users might have specified duplicates, this can't happen for the other ways
*/
......
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ment